释义 | † piluliferousadj. Botany. Obsolete. rare. Bearing fruits or flowers that resemble pills in size or shape. ΘΚΠ the world > plants > part of plant > reproductive part(s) > fruit or reproductive product > plant that bears fruit > [adjective] > bearing fruit or fruitful > of specific form piluliferous1697 angiocarpous1835 amphicarpic1846 platycarpous1858 strombuliferous1859 trachycarpous1860 amphicarpous1866 1697 Philos. Trans. 1695–7 (Royal Soc.) 19 438 The Tamarisk of Egypt, call'd Atle;..and the Piluliferous one of Monomopata, esteemed by our Author the true Acacalis of Dioscorides and Paulus. 1771 R. Weston Universal Botanist II. 311 Piluliferous Ceylon Spurge. 1858 R. G. Mayne Expos. Lexicon Med. Sci. (1860) 964/2 Piluliferus, the Urtica pilulifera is so named because of its fruits, which, by their union, form a globulous mass: piluliferous.
